Everyone wears some type of label. These may have been given to us by others like nicknames or maybe things that we have given ourselves. Sometimes these are good, but they can also be bad. So in this world of labels, how do we know who we really are? Before we dive into this, I want you to watch a video that will help clarify the issue for us:

Now that we have an idea of the labels that exist, lets dive into this subject.

If you think back to high school, or if you are in high school you can probably think of some labels that were placed on you. Those labels began to make you think that you were what they say, even if that wasn’t you. You begin to believe the lies that people around you are telling you.

The real issue that we face is not what labels we have but what voices we listen to. Casting Crowns sees that this is an issue, and addresses it in their song Voice of Truth. The end of the chorus says:

Out of all the voices calling out to me
I will choose to listen and believe the voice of truth

In a world of messed up morals and lies, the only voice that we can truly rely on is that of Christ.  Sometimes it is so hard to listen to the voice of God, because it isn’t always the loudest, but most of the time the still soft whisper of our Creator. God doesn’t do this so that we can’t hear him, but rather so that we seek him to hear what he is saying to us.

So what keeps us from hearing the voice of God? Its quite simple, but something that we don’t even realize we do. We love to hang onto labels, because the longer we listen to the other voices, the more we become that label. We begin to allow ourselves to find our identity in the lies we are told. There is a quote that says:

A lie, if told enough times, becomes truth

What we fail to realize is that once we step into a relationship with Jesus Christ, we become a new creation! 

2 Corinthians 5:17 says

Therefore, if anyone is in Christ, he is a new creation; the old has gone, the new has come!

This verse gives us freedom to remove the labels the world has given us in the past! We are no longer who we were before Christ, but we are made new and pure by the blood of Jesus Christ!

Since that is true, we can no longer be defined by our clothing, cars, money, jewelry, makeup, hair style, or house. We are found to be alive in Christ, and we should listen to the label that our Creator has given to us. We must be willing to change and break free of the labels that we carry.

If you are holding on to labels dive into the word of God. As you get to know more about your Creator, He will reveal more of your purpose to you. This isn’t something that happens overnight and can take years to figure out. The beauty of it is that you will be free from living in the lies of the world and free to share your life with others.

There are so many voices calling out to us. It’s our choice which voice to believe and follow.
